Types of Historical & Architectural Tours in Hvar

Hvar Old Town Walking Tours

These tours focus on the heart of Hvar Town, exploring its labyrinthine cobblestone streets, picturesque squares, and significant buildings. Guides often highlight the Venetian influence, Roman remnants, and the daily life that has unfolded here for centuries.

Fortica (Fortress) & Town Views

Many historical tours include a visit to the impressive Fortica (Španjola Fortress) overlooking Hvar Town. These excursions delve into the fortress's military history and offer unparalleled panoramic views of the town, the Pakleni Islands, and the Adriatic Sea.

What to Expect on Historical & Architectural Tours in Hvar

Duration

Most historical and architectural walking tours typically last between 2 to 4 hours, allowing for a thorough exploration of key sites without being overly strenuous.

Weather

Hvar enjoys a Mediterranean climate. Tours often run in sunny conditions, so sun protection (hats, sunscreen) is advisable. Some tours might be offered in the cooler mornings or late afternoons.

Group Size

Group sizes can vary, from intimate private tours to larger shared excursions. Smaller groups generally allow for more interaction with the guide and a more personalized experience.

What's Included

Typically includes a guided tour by a licensed local historian or guide. Entrance fees to specific paid attractions (like parts of the fortress) may or may not be included, so check tour details carefully.

Meeting Point

Most tours commence in a central, easily accessible location in Hvar Town, often near the main square (Pjaca) or the waterfront, making them convenient to find.

Costs

Prices for group tours can range from approximately $30 to $70 USD per person, with private tours costing more. Prices depend on the duration, group size, and specific inclusions.

Q:What is the difference between an architectural tour and a historical tour?

A: While often overlapping, an architectural tour specifically focuses on the design, styles, and construction of buildings, explaining their aesthetic and engineering significance. A historical tour casts a broader net, covering events, people, and social context, often using architecture as a backdrop to tell these stories.

Q:What are the most significant historical periods covered by Hvar tours?

A: Hvar tours typically cover periods such as the ancient Greek colonization, Roman presence, medieval development, the significant Venetian rule (15th-18th centuries), and the Austro-Hungarian era. You'll see evidence and hear stories from each of these eras.

Transportation Tips

Navigating Hvar is straightforward. Within Hvar Town, walking is best; most attractions are clustered. For exploring further afield, renting a scooter or car offers flexibility, especially for reaching hidden beaches and inland villages. Local buses connect major towns, but schedules can be limited. Taxis are available, though pricier. Day trips to the Pakleni Islands are easily arranged via numerous water taxi services from Hvar Town harbor, making getting around Hvar's archipelago simple and enjoyable.
